LOST :: TIME Theory
The TIME Theory is very interesting. Crafted by SpOOky on the 4815162342.com forum, this theory basically concludes that time itself is flowing in a loop on the island. The example they use is that the hatch explosion we saw in the Season 2 finale blew the door off the hatch, which (in some kind of time warp) hit the plane and caused it to crash, allowing the survivors to land on the island, find the hatch, not push the numbers, and start the loop all over again.
Seems a little far-fetched at first, but if the same thing are happening again and again, things could have happened on several previous loops that would explain some of the stranmge things that have happened. If the Others have experimented on the Losties, they may have helped Sun get pregnant, healed Locke and Rose, etc. This would also explain how they know so much about the survivors, even to the point where they think they know what Sun will and will not do in a specific situation.

I believe the metal hull of the plane was "bent" by the magnetism just like every metal object on the island moved when the hatch collapsed (all dharma conserves fall out of their racks at the beachcamp).
The scene where the others wittness the crash shows the plane making "metalbending" noises before it spontaneously broke in half and fell from the sky.
